The star striker of Tampere Ilves Matias Mantykivi has been banned for one match for Saturday’s events.
The league’s disciplinary delegation considered that Mäntykivi tried to kick KalPa Andreas Okanya towards. Mantykivi responded to the discipline that he tried to kick Okany’s stick, not the player himself.
– When Okany is getting up from the ice, Mäntykivi performs a wide-arcing and powerful kick with his right foot. In the kick, Mäntykivi’s leg swings close to Okany, who is frozen and rising up. The kick does not hit Okany or his stick.
– The disciplinary delegation considers that Mäntykivi has recklessly endangered the safety of the opponent with his actions, and taking into account the circumstances of the act, it is appropriate to impose a suspension for the act, the decision said.
No penalty was awarded for the situation in the match itself.
Mäntykivi, 24, has played 38 matches this season with an output of 11+20=31.
